解决vue打包报错Unexpected token name «t», expected punc «;» 和Unexpected token: punc (,)的问题

在这里插入图片描述

老项目之前打包一直没有问题,且此次项目启动运行依然正常,但打包报了上述错误,因此肯定跟打包配置有关,且与UglifyJs有关,于是百度了一下,找到了如下解决方案,且成功解决了我的问题。


new webpack.optimize.UglifyJsPlugin({
   
      output: {
   
        comments: false, // 去掉注释
      },
      compress: {
   
        warnings: false,
        pure_funcs: ["console.log"], //移除console
      },
      exclude: /(node_modules|

版权声明:本文为weixin_40808668原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。